While it may seem like everyone's attention is now focused on the automotive sector, the reality is that interest in the smartphone domain remains high. Particularly in the mid-range segment, with the likes of Redmi, OnePlus, and realme stepping up, the competition has intensified. However, what's unexpected is that iQOO has ventured into imaging within the mid-range market. ?url=http%3A%2F%2Fdingyue.ws.126.net%2F2024%2F0421%2F47f00ca4j00sc9via00djd001jk01bnm.jpg&thumbnail=660x2147483647&quality=80&type=jpg Although iQOO hasn't provided specific camera parameters, they've indicated that the iQOO Z9 Turbo will feature algorithms and features from flagship devices. These include fun fisheye camera effects, night mode algorithms, motion capture, 2X portrait mode, and more. Judging from the official sample photos released, the overall performance looks quite impressive. Typically, in the mid-range segment, people prioritize performance and battery life, with camera quality being just sufficient. It's rare for a brand in this segment to emphasize imaging capabilities. Surprisingly, the iQOO Z9 Turbo not only boasts powerful performance (with the Snapdragon 8s Gen3) and long battery life (6000mAh Blue Whale high-density battery), but also aims to compete for the best imaging capabilities in its class, even surpassing some of vivo's flagship features and algorithms. ?url=http%3A%2F%2Fdingyue.ws.126.net%2F2024%2F0421%2F8d5c0fb7j00sc9via001vd000j600pkm.jpg&thumbnail=660x2147483647&quality=80&type=jpg Meanwhile, it has been officially confirmed that the Blue Heart XiaoV has also been decentralized, and it is fully supported across the board. Blue Heart XiaoV can generate text in real-time through voice, provide AI summaries, and much more. It's estimated that vivo's Blue Heart large model will also be decentralized, especially since some brands have already begun calling themselves "the first AI smartphone for young people" in this category.
